当前位置: 首页 > news >正文

测试平台如何重塑CI/CD流程中的质量协作新范式

测试平台如何重塑CI/CD流程中的质量协作新范式

在DevOps革命席卷全球软件行业的今天,测试的角色正在经历前所未有的转变。传统的"测试最后"模式正在被"测试全程"的新理念所取代,这一转变背后是测试平台与CI/CD流程深度融合带来的质量协作革命。Gitee Test等新一代测试平台通过五大核心能力的进化,正在重新定义软件质量保障的方式和效率。

测试用例自动化与CI/CD的无缝集成已经成为现代软件开发的基础设施。Gitee Test平台通过开放的API接口与主流CI工具形成深度整合,使得测试活动不再是独立于开发流程的"孤岛"。从代码提交触发自动构建,到测试用例自动执行,再到结果反馈的全闭环流程,测试用例已经真正成为CI/CD流水线中的一等公民。这种整合不仅大幅提升了测试的执行效率,更重要的是将质量反馈周期从过去的数小时甚至数天缩短到分钟级别,为持续交付提供了坚实保障。

缺陷追踪与构建系统的智能联动代表着测试平台的另一项突破性创新。Gitehe Test平台通过实时监控构建过程,能够自动将构建失败转化为缺陷卡片,并关联相关代码变更、测试用例和责任人信息。这种自动化缺陷创建机制不仅节省了人工提单的时间成本,更重要的是通过精准的问题定位和上下文关联,将缺陷修复周期平均缩短了40%以上。当开发者收到构建失败通知时,系统已经自动生成了包含失败原因、相关代码和修复建议的完整缺陷报告,极大提升了问题解决效率。

在安全至上的数字时代,DevSecOps理念的落地离不开测试平台的安全能力整合。Gitee Test通过内置的Scan模块实现了安全测试与常规功能测试的无缝衔接。每一次代码提交都会触发自动化的安全扫描,发现的安全漏洞会像功能缺陷一样被追踪和管理。这种集成消除了传统安全测试的滞后性,将安全问题发现和修复的成本降低了一个数量级。据统计,采用这种集成安全测试模式的企业,其关键安全漏洞的平均修复时间从过去的7天缩短至8小时以内。

测试报告的实时性和智能化为团队协作提供了全新的可能性。Gitee Test的报告模板系统能够根据不同类型的测试活动自动生成结构化的质量报告,并实时更新到构建日志和相关协作工具中。这种动态报告机制确保了所有利益相关者都能获取到最新、最相关的质量信息。项目经理可以查看项目维度的质量趋势,开发者可以聚焦与自己相关的缺陷详情,测试工程师可以分析测试覆盖率的演进——所有人都能从同一个数据源获取自己需要的视角,彻底改变了传统测试报告"一刀切"的局限。

现代测试平台最根本的创新在于打破了角色间的协作壁垒。Gitee Test作为集成式DevSecOps平台,为开发、测试、运维和安全团队提供了统一的协作界面。测试活动不再是测试团队的专属责任,而是成为了整个研发流程的自然组成部分。开发者可以在编码时查看关联的测试用例,测试工程师可以参与代码评审,安全专家可以监控实时风险——这种跨职能协作模式将传统的线性交付流程转化为并行的质量共建生态。数据显示,采用这种协作模式的企业,其功能缺陷密度平均降低了35%,而交付速度却提升了50%。

测试平台与CI/CD流程的深度融合正在引发一场静悄悄的质量革命。从被动的质量把关到主动的质量共建,从孤立的测试活动到全流程的质量协同,测试平台已经演变为软件研发的核心基础设施。Gitee Test等平台通过测试自动化、缺陷管理智能化、安全测试集成化、报告系统实时化和跨角色协作无缝化五大创新,为现代软件开发提供了全新的质量保障范式。在这个快速迭代的时代,选择能够自然融入CI/CD流程的测试平台,已经成为企业构建高质量软件的核心竞争力。

http://www.dtcms.com/a/309364.html

相关文章:

  • LLM Prompt与开源模型资源(1)提示词工程介绍
  • 全新发布|知影-API风险监测系统V3.3,AI赋能定义数据接口安全新坐标
  • HTML无尽射击小游戏包含源码,纯HTML+CSS+JS
  • Redis 中 ZipList 的级联更新问题
  • Dockerfile详解 笔记250801
  • fingerprintjs/botd爬虫监听
  • Ajax笔记
  • SD-WAN在煤矿机械设备工厂智能化转型中的应用与网络架构优化
  • ansible.cfg 配置文件的常见配置项及其说明
  • AI量化模型解析黄金3300关口博弈:市场聚焦“非农数据”的GRU-RNN混合架构推演
  • 【立体标定】圆形标定板标定python实现
  • MySQL学习从零开始--第六部分
  • PyTorch 分布式训练全解析:从原理到实践
  • 数据仓库、数据湖与湖仓一体技术笔记
  • 第三章 网络安全基础(一)
  • OPENGLPG第九版学习 - 纹理与帧缓存 part2
  • linux中posix消息队列的使用记录
  • Java与Kotlin中“==“、“====“区别
  • 解锁 Grok-4 —— 技术架构、核心能力与API获取指南
  • 梯度下降的基本原理
  • 如何改变Jupyter的默认保存路径?
  • 电子邮箱域名解析原理
  • Scene as Occupancy
  • 深入剖析Spring IOC容器——原理、源码与实践全解析
  • Charles中文版抓包工具详解 实现API调试提效与流量分析优化
  • 肖特基二极管MBR0540T1G 安森美ON 低电压 高频率 集成电路IC 芯片
  • Linux 系统监控脚本实战:磁盘空间预警、Web 服务与访问测试全流程
  • 嵌入式 Linux 深度解析:架构、原理与工程实践(增强版)
  • 60 GHz DreamHAT+ 雷达已被正式批准为“Powered by Raspberry Pi”产品
  • 浏览器【详解】requestIdleCallback(浏览器空闲时执行)